It depends on whether they are full time are partial day. Cody got in

on the 3mornings a week and the cost is 1265. This is not really a

beneficial and I am trying to supplement my income so he can go 5 days

and I know it is around 2000 for that. 6 hours a day is about 3200 to

3600. Bevins is over the day treatment program and Christie

Enzinna is over her. There are numerous BCBA's available for behaviors

and our kids for some reason have plenty of those. It seems we think

we have over come one behavior and 6 more come up.:)
